Pipeline gas demonstration plant: Phase I. Record environmental analysis report. Volume II, Book 2. [Illinois Coal Gasification Group; Perry County]

The projected major impacts associated with the construction and operation of a coal gasification plant on the Perry County site are summarized. There are three major impacts associated with the project. One is the daily conversion of approximately 2330 tons of coal into 24.0 MM SCFD of SPG. The COGAS process converts high-sulfur and other varieties of coal to SPG. When combusted, this gas produces fewer air pollutants than either oil or coal. This is one beneficial impact of the project. The second beneficial impact of the project is on employment and the economy of the twelve county region. A significant number of jobs for local construction workers will be generated over the 34-month construction period. During Plant operation, approximately 415 jobs will be created. These added employment opportunities will result in the dispersal of a significant amount of revenue within the twelve county region. In addition to the employment and revenues generated as a direct result of Plant construction and operation, induced or secondary jobs and revenues will develop in the twelve county region. Secondary jobs will further reduce the unemployment rate in the twelve counties. Atmospheric emissions will be produced during construction and operation. Construction activities will produce emissions from vehicular traffic, earthmoving, and combustion of debris. The quantities of air pollutants produced during operation of the Plant are summarized in Table 4.3.1-1. The quantities of atmospheric emissions, during construction and operation, meet the most stringent requirements of the USEPA.
